Telangana government has come up with T Hub to give a fillip to the Hyderabad innovation ecosystem.
It is the brainchild of IT Minister, K Taraka Ramarao.
The T Hub’s first phase was a grand success and contributed to Hyderabad’s startup culture success.
According to one estimate, as many as 1,100 startups have been impacted by T-Hub, ₹ 1,860 crore funds raised by cohort startups, and more than 100 exclusive programs offered.
Now, T Hub’s second phase is all set for inauguration.
Telangana Chief Minister K Chandrasekhar Rao will be inaugurating the new facility on the 28th of this month.
The State government has invested more than ₹ 300 crores in the facility.
The new building comes with a total built-up area of over 5.82 lakh square feet which makes it the world’s largest innovation campus, the second largest being startup incubator Station F based in France.
Phase two of this project will double the opportunities and help Hyderabad compete with Bengaluru the startup capital of India.
